Acid rain

Acid rain is a type of pollution in which sulfur dioxide (SO2) and nitrogen oxides (NOx) are released into the atmosphere, usually as a result of burning fossil fuels such as coal and oil. These pollutants can combine with water vapor in the atmosphere to form sulfuric acid and nitric acid, which can then fall to the ground as rain, snow, or fog. Acid rain can harm plants, animals, and bodies of water, and it can also damage buildings and other structures. The term "acid rain" is often used to refer to the deposition of acidifying compounds, rather than the acidity of precipitation.

The main cause of acid rain is the release of sulfur dioxide (SO2) and nitrogen oxides (NOx) into the atmosphere, primarily from the burning of fossil fuels such as coal and oil. These pollutants can come from power plants, factories, and automobiles.

In power plants, coal is burned to produce electricity, and the sulfur in the coal combines with oxygen to form SO2. Similarly, in factories and automobiles, fuel is burned to power engines, and the sulfur in the fuel combines with oxygen to form SO2.

NOx is also produced by burning fossil fuels, as well as by other processes such as lightning and volcanic eruptions. Once in the atmosphere, these pollutants can be carried long distances by wind and can eventually fall to the ground as acid rain.

Additionally, the process of deforestation and industrial activity like mining also contribute to acid rain by releasing sulfur and nitrogen compounds into the air.

Acid rain can have a variety of negative effects on the environment and on human health. Some of the most notable effects include:

  • Damage to plants and trees: Acid rain can damage the leaves of plants and trees, making them more susceptible to disease and pests. It can also inhibit the growth of new leaves and needles, and can even cause entire stands of trees to die.

  • Damage to bodies of water: Acid rain can make bodies of water more acidic, which can harm or kill fish and other aquatic life. It can also dissolve the shells of aquatic animals such as clams and snails.

  • Damage to buildings and other structures: Acid rain can erode stone, brick, and other building materials, and can also damage paint and metal surfaces.

  • Human health effects: Acid rain can aggravate respiratory problems such as asthma and bronchitis, and can also cause eye, nose, and throat irritation.

  • Climate change: The emissions that cause acid rain also contribute to the greenhouse effect, which leads to global warming and climate change.

Acid rain can also have economic impacts, such as reduced crop yields, reduced fish and wildlife populations, and damage to infrastructure.
